Re: Banksia GUI released
To have sounds when engines vs engines you need to turn sound on (on Settings dialog), then in the sound configuration dialog (click to the button next to "Sound" checkbox to open it), tick "Engine moves", "Normal games", "Tournament games" as the bellow image.
Sounds will be played for displaying games only but not games running in the background of tournaments.

Re: Banksia GUI released
Is it possible to setup a chess position and have two engines play against each other starting from that position? If not could you consider adding it?
I would like to be able to give an old engine knight odds versus a newer engine.
Thank you..

Re: Banksia GUI released
Yes and it’s just a quick setup.
If you have that position, just copy and paste it into BSG. BSG can understand FEN, PGN, UCI positions (such as “position startpos moves e2e4 e7e6”).
If you don’t have that position, you may edit to have (menu -> Edit -> Edit Board, Fig. 1). You may also make moves manually (set the game to human vs human then make moves for both sides).
Once you have a game with a give position you will need to set up engines. Menu -> File -> Game setup to open a dialog as the Fig. 2, select engines for both sides (as well as a timer, options) then press the button "OK".
Now from the toolbar, click on the button "Play" until it changed to green as Fig. 3.
All done, have fun
